The University of Virginia is a public research institution located in Charlottesville, Virginia. Founded in 1819, it boasts nationally ranked schools and programs, diverse and distinguished faculty, and a major academic medical center. The community and culture of the University are enriched by active student self-governance, sustained commitment to the arts and a robust NCAA Division I Athletics program committed to academic and athletic excellence. Virginia Athletics sponsors a twenty-seven sport intercollegiate athletics program, which includes approximately 750 student-athletes. UVA has recently launched its most ambitious fundraising effort in its 200+ year history with the $5B Honor the Future comprehensive campaign.

The Department of Athletics seeks an Associate Director of Development. Reporting to the Director of Athletics, the Associate Director will work in close coordination with the Virginia Athletics Foundation and University Advancement. As a member of the team, the Associate Director will be responsible for identification, cultivation, solicitation, and stewardship of new major and principal gift prospective donors.

The Associate Director will pursue philanthropic support to advance the athletics departments overall fundraising priorities and strategic engagement initiatives with a specific emphasis on identifying new donors interested in supporting the Virginia Athletics Master Plan. In this role, the Associate Director will be donor-centric in their approach and work collaboratively to build strong relationships and coalitions across the Grounds with advancement colleagues, not only in the Virginia Athletics Foundation, but within University Advancement, and our schools/units.

Key Duties and Responsibilities

  • Work actively to identify, cultivate, solicit and steward new major and principal gifts donors.
  • Work actively to establish and re-establish connections to inactive donors.
  • Execute strategic fundraising plan with short- and long-range goals to the expand donor base.
  • Work with Director of Athletics and/or other leaders to cultivate and solicit lead gifts to high-profile athletics projects.
  • Build and maintain key relationships in support of philanthropic efforts for the department of athletics.
  • Identify and partner with key constituents to leverage corporate and foundation fundraising opportunities.
  • Analyze and utilize prospect research data and insights to identify fundraising opportunities.
  • Conduct face-to face gift solicitations on an ongoing basis to meet fundraising objectives.
  • Create and maintain a portfolio of donor prospects.
  • Manage and appropriately document prospect contacts, solicitations, and proposals.
  • Adhere to University and University Advancement policies and protocols.
